Giter VIP home page Giter VIP logo

flappy-bird's Introduction

Flappy-Bird

banner

A ridiculous game created by Flutter, all you have to do is touch the screen to make the bird leap as long as you avoid the barriers, you'll be OK. Depending on how long you play for, the score will be calculated. On the screen, your top score will always be displayed.

Hive is a lightweight, user-friendly, and ❤️ Simple, powerful database with 🎈 NO native dependencies that we utilize.

Trim

Features ⚡️

  • You may choose the color of the bird.
  • The background can be modified.
  • You can choose the level of difficulty.
  • The music can be muted.

Issues

  • The barriers are not 100% accurate
  • According to the screen boundaries, there's no landscape mode.

Colors

Group 1 Group 2 Group 6 Group 5 Group 4 Group 9 Group 8 Group 3 Group 7

Installation

you can just download the .apk file from the Release.

if you clone it just run

$ flutter pub get

🤓 Good people




Techniques used 🛠️

preview

  • Minimum SDK level 21
  • Architecture
    • MVC
  • Hive - GetX is an extra-light and powerful solution for Flutter.
  • flutter_launcher_icons - A command-line tool that simplifies the task of updating your Flutter app's launcher icon.
  • audio_players - A Flutter plugin to play multiple audio files simultaneously
  • webview_flutter - A Flutter plugin that provides a WebView widget on Android and iOS
  • Http - A composable, multi-platform, Future-based API for HTTP requests.
  • url_launcher - Flutter plugin for launching a URL. Supports web, phone, SMS, and email schemes.
  • path_provider - Flutter plugin for getting commonly used locations on host platform file systems, such as the temp and app data directories.
  • url_launcher - Render After Effects animations natively on Flutter. This package is a pure Dart implementation of a Lottie player
  • smooth_star_rating_null_safety - A smooth rating bar

This game is the culmination of the University-sponsored Next Academy's flutter programming instruction.

flappy-bird's People

Contributors

moha-b avatar wvzv avatar linah31 avatar bhargavraviya av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.